World Nepali Knowledge Conference-2027 to be held in collaboration with NRNA

. Non-Resident Nepali Association (NRNA) has intensified its preparations for the Fourth World Nepali Knowledge Conference-2027 BS. In connection with the preparations for the conference, the NRNA delegation held separate meetings with the Minister for Foreign Affairs and Minister for Science, Technology and Innovation and presented the concept paper for the conference.

During the meeting, NRNA Vice-President and Head of Skills, Knowledge and Technology Transfer Department Dr.TAG_OPEN_div_26 Gyanendra Regmi spoke about the need of linking knowledge, skills, technology and experience of Nepali experts, scientists, researchers, technicians and entrepreneurs with the national priorities. He said the conference will not only be a discussion forum but will not only be a discussion but will also become a common forum for result-oriented collaboration among the government, academic and research institutions, private sector and Nepali experts from around the world.

Recalling the 1st World Nepali Knowledge Conference held in 2018, Foreign Minister Pokharel said such conferences had played significant role in expanding knowledge exchange and collaboration among Nepali experts in Nepal and around the world.TAG_OPEN_div_24 He also said the government was positive to provide necessary cooperation for the success of the 4th World Nepali Knowledge Conference-2027 BS and expressed the government’s commitment to utilize knowledge and experience of Nepalis living abroad for Nepal’s development.

On the occasion, NRNA Vice-President and Chief of Non-Resident Nepali Welfare Department, Rojina Pradhan Rai urged the government to implement the Non-Resident Nepali Citizenship Act, give final shape to the NRNA Act at the earliest and implement facilities like land, investment, banking, visa and driving license.TAG_OPEN_div_22 In response, the Foreign Minister said that preparations were underway to amend some legal provisions related to property, investment and visa.

The delegation also met with Pushpa Raj Bhattarai, Chief of Labour, Migration and Nepali Diaspora Coordination Division at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and discussed the preparations for the World Knowledge Summit-2027, the Non-Resident Nepali Act, government-NRNA coordination and the utilization of knowledge and skills of Nepali Diaspora for Nepal’s development.TAG_OPEN_div_20 Preparations for Europe and Asia-Pacific Regional Summit were also exchanged.

Meanwhile, the delegation also met with Minister for Science, Technology and Innovation Mahabir Pun and presented the concept paper of the conference.TAG_OPEN_div_18 Stating that the Summit could make significant contributions in building innovation, research, technology development and knowledge-based economy in Nepal, the leaders said, adding that the collaboration between the two countries could be significant.

Minister Pun pointed out the need to effectively connect knowledge and experience of Nepali experts, scientists, researchers and entrepreneurs living abroad with Nepal’s development.TAG_OPEN_div_16 Stating that preparations were underway to bring the brain gain centre into operation again, he said the active participation of Nepali experts from around the world was essential to make the campaign a success.

The fourth World Nepali Knowledge Conference-2027 will be held in January 2027.TAG_OPEN_div_14 The conference aims to create a base for long-term collaboration among the government, educational and research institutions, private sector and Nepali Diaspora linking their knowledge, research, innovation, technology and experience with the national priorities of good governance, economic transformation and sustainable development.
